Transaction 7e86aeddc1b9752355346b3fcbe9eaad3f9dfae5f6610023574823e8eab26561

10 Input
2 Outputs
  • 7e86aeddc1b9752355346b3fcbe9eaad3f9dfae5f6610023574823e8eab26561:0
  • value  4308149
    address  15ZGGDHgN3sLMdwKyBAgWLgkT3pS39iyw9
  • 7e86aeddc1b9752355346b3fcbe9eaad3f9dfae5f6610023574823e8eab26561:1
  • value  114174
    address  bc1qwwc7t82j8z5uuavkdw0rtee6mldmkyrrntknm8